Transaction f2823579a269310541ba181c4ecf8a18080f55ee1056fe9b36905535798e3d94

5 Input
2 Outputs
  • f2823579a269310541ba181c4ecf8a18080f55ee1056fe9b36905535798e3d94:0
  • value  142965900
    address  12av9inJMViftHiM9DTWP7GLWPF7soRFwY
  • f2823579a269310541ba181c4ecf8a18080f55ee1056fe9b36905535798e3d94:1
  • value  9400451
    address  1Ccb4vrC5atJHHdj3hHhYwJmYxtVZLZXWc